Simply downloading the software isn't enough; you need the right hardware interface to bridge your PC and the battery.
The Cable: You need a USB to RS232 (RJ45 or RJ11) console cable. Note that a standard Ethernet cable will not work. Most Pylontech units use the "Console" port (RS232) for BatteryView communication.
Drivers: Ensure your USB-to-Serial adapter drivers (often FTDI or CH340) are installed so your Windows Device Manager recognizes a "COM Port." How to Use BatteryView Safely
Connect the Cable: Plug the USB into your laptop and the RJ45/RJ11 into the battery's Console port.
Set the Baud Rate: Open BatteryView. The standard baud rate for most Pylontech units is 115200 or 9600.
Identify the Battery: Click "Connect." If successful, the software will populate with the Serial Number and BMS data.
Read-Only Mode: Unless you are a certified technician, avoid changing "Parameters." Simply use the software to "Read" data to avoid voiding your warranty. Summary Checklist Keyword: BatteryView.exe Compatibility: Pylontech US-Series

Once you have downloaded the verified ZIP file, follow these steps to get started:
Extract the Files: BatteryView usually runs as a "portable" app, meaning you don't need to install it. Just extract the folder to your desktop.
Driver Setup: Ensure you have the drivers installed for your Console Cable (most use the FTDI or CP210x chipsets).
Physical Connection: Plug the RJ45 end into the "Console" port of your master Pylontech battery and the USB end into your PC. Launch: Run BatteryView.exe. Configuration:
Select the correct COM Port (check Device Manager if unsure).
Set the Baud Rate (typically 115200 for newer models or 9600 for older units). Click "Connect" or "Start". Safety Warning: Firmware Updates Understanding BatteryView
While BatteryView allows for firmware flashing, do not attempt to update your firmware unless specifically instructed by Pylontech support. Flashing the wrong version for your specific hardware revision can permanently disable the battery.

Drivers: You will need the Prolific PL2303 or FTDI drivers, depending on your Console-to-USB cable. 🔌 Connection Requirements
You cannot use a standard Ethernet or USB cable alone; you need a specific interface. Cable: Use a USB-to-RS232 (RJ45) console cable.
Port: Connect to the Console port on the master battery (not the CAN/RS485 ports).
Baud Rate: Typically 115200 for US2000C/US3000C models, or 9600 for older US2000B models. 📊 Key Features of BatteryView
Once connected and you click "Start", the software provides deep-level diagnostics:
Cell Voltage: View the individual voltage of every cell to check for imbalances.
SOH & SOC: Track the State of Health and State of Charge accurately.
Cycle Count: See exactly how many times the battery has been discharged.
Temperature: Monitor internal sensors to ensure the rack is cooling properly.
History Logs: Export .txt or .csv files for warranty claims or performance analysis. ⚠️ Important Safety Tips Read-Only: Use BatteryView primarily for monitoring.
Firmware: Do not attempt to upload firmware via BatteryView unless instructed by Pylontech support; a failed flash can brick the BMS.
Master Battery: Always connect to the unit that has the Link Port 0 empty (the "Master" in the stack).
💡 Pro Tip: If the program opens but shows no data, check your Device Manager to confirm which COM Port your cable is assigned to, then match that in the BatteryView settings. If you'd like, I can help you: Find the pinout diagram for a DIY console cable
